user_unpack_cuts

 

int user_unpack_cuts(void *user, int from, int one_row_only, int varnum, 
                     var_desc **vars, int cutnum, cut_data **cuts,
                     int *new_row_num, waiting_row ***new_rows)

Description:

The user has to interpret the given cuts as constraints for the current LP relaxation, i.e., he must decode the compact representation of the cuts (see the cut_data structure) into rows for the matrix. A pointer to the array of generated rows must be returned in ***new_rows (the user has to allocate this array) and their number in *new_row_num.

There is no post processing. There are no built-in default options.
